
River of Fire is an incredible read. It is historically accurate; that was important to me, as the true story is more compelling than fiction. The way that Nancy Gentry weaves the personal stories of her major characters throughout the novel makes it a compelling story. River of Fire makes the story come alive and leaves the reader with a better understanding of the horror of the Sultana tragedy--Back cover.
